Mrs. Anna Mary Reffner, wife of Jerry Reffner, died last evening at her home on Locust street, Roaring Spring, of pleuro-pneumonia after an illness of ten days. She was born in McKee in December, 1881, the daughter of Israel, deceased, and Mary Musselman, and was married fifteen years ago. She had resided in Roaring Spring for eleven years. Surviving are the mother, the husband and one son, Garry, aged 11, and two sisters, Mrs. Harriet Eckard and Mrs. Mattie Heuston, both of Roaring Spring. She was a member of the Church of God. The funeral will be held on Thursday at 2.30 o'clock with services in charge of Rev. J. A. Detter. Interment will be made at Vicksburg. Altoona Times, Altoona, Pa., Thursday Morning, October 24, 1918
